This is a popular campsite praised for its amazing riverside location, spacious pitches, and relaxed atmosphere. Families particularly enjoy the river access, with rope swings a highlight. Facilities are generally clean, though some guests mention they are basic. While many appreciate the 'wild camping' feel, a few noted noise from other campers, especially during busy periods. New toilet and shower facilities are being installed.

Liked Fantastic site, basic but facilities very clean throughout the stay.
Access to shallow river all along one side with rope swings dotted along the way. Great for families. Full of friendly people while we were there. Fire pits and wood available from site if wanted.
Tried the paddleboard but could only get as far as the golf course, fast flowing but incredibly difficult due to being heavily reeded and blocked by fallen/low lying trees so quite dangerous in parts.
Pockets where there are swings are clear so safe for older/capable children.
